MEMO — Q3 Cash-Flow Forecast

To: Finance Team, Dorrit & Hale Logistics

Q3 forecast revised. Receivables from the Calverton contract slip 30 days; net operating inflow down 9%. Capex on the Brimley depot deferred. Credit line headroom adequate but tight in week 8. Updated model circulates Friday. Review variances before the close call. The confidential planning note that drives these assumptions follows immediately below.

internal memo for yahag-tahog: The pricing group signed off on a budget of $152.8 million for Project Soriel.

Subject: Spokewise rebalancer 2.7 — release notes for security review

This release of the Spokewise bike-share rebalancing tool restricts depot-transfer suggestions to authenticated dispatcher roles, removes the legacy CSV import path flagged in the last review, and encrypts cached station inventories at rest. No new external endpoints were introduced. Threat-model deltas are documented in the review folder. The signed artifact corresponds to the identifier below.

trace token, fafog-kageg: htk4_98e6

Subject: Score sheets — Merrowdale Regional Final

Dispatch: the signed score sheets from the Merrowdale chess final are in envelope pack C, sealed by the chief arbiter last night. These are the only originals; results can't be ratified without them. Courier from Pellan Express collects at 07:30 and runs them straight to the federation office in Cardo Heights. No detours, no copies made en route. Confirm ID, then give the courier the phrase shown on the line below.

handover note for yagef-bagep: the drudor pelius courier leaves the kasdor zorvan norir ledger at gate 8016 under passcode 755406

### Notes — Tuesday sync

The session-token refresh bug on Bramblecart is still biting: tokens sometimes refresh twice and invalidate the active session. Workaround for on-call: bounce the Tollery auth pods, which clears the stale refresh queue. Fix is targeted for next sprint. If it pages overnight, escalate straight to the engineer who owns it.

account owner for bawip-tahag: Raleth Quenok